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

La formación del profesorado es una de las apuestas para la integración de las tecnologías de la información y comunicación (TIC) en la función docente. En este trabajo pretendemos conocer qué factores influyen en la transferencia de las formaciones en TIC destinadas al profesorado universitario, así como abordar la visión de los expertos y formadores sobre la orientación pedagógica de estas formaciones. Para ello, se han realizado entrevistas semiestructuradas a 19 expertos/as en tecnología educativa y formadores/as en TIC de universidades públicas españolas. Tras los resultados, el artículo concluye con una serie de recomendaciones para mejorar la aplicación de lo aprendido a la función docente.
